Heart transplant after a hepatitis C–positive donor

Transplant; Failure, HeartHepatitis C

Part of Digestive system, Infections clinical trials.

This trial follows people who receive a heart from a donor whose blood tested positive for hepatitis C. It also includes people getting a heart transplant again, and it aims to learn about outcomes and safety for these specific transplant situations.

Phase
N/A
Enrollment
500 people
Ages
18 years and older
Study type
Observational

Who can take part

  • You received a heart from a donor whose blood test was positive for hepatitis C
  • You received a heart transplant (not just evaluation for one)
  • If you are having another heart transplant, you may still qualify
  • You did not receive multiple organs in the transplant
